Introduction

Construction of our building was completed in 1922 and City Road Baptist Church formally opened its doors on 23 April 1923.

LIFE EVENTS

Baptism

Baptism involves the total immersion of a person into water in the name of the Father, the Son and the Holy Spirit on their own profession of faith. As Baptists we do not baptise infants but only those who are of an age to make a clear declaration of their own free will. By means of baptism, a person declares their desire to turn from a life without God to one which is lived for God through Jesus Christ. Christian faith is not something that anybody can choose for anyone other than themselves

Dedications

At City Road Baptist Church, we do not baptise infants because we believe that the decision to be a disciple of Jesus is one that can only properly be made at a later stage of spiritual development. However we do welcome children into the community by means of a special service known as a Dedication.

In keeping with the attitude and actions of Jesus, we welcome children and take seriously His invitation, ‘Whoever welcomes one such child in my name welcomes me’ (Matthew 18:5).
